PASMA Training is the most extensively recognised form of mobile access tower training in the UK.
The work at height regulations 2005 require that anyone using mobile access towers must be competent, or under the supervision of a competent person.
A competent person must be able to demonstrate that they have the sufficient training, knowledge and experience in order to carry out their duties responsibly. They must also be able to understand any potential hazards or technical defects related to the work / equipment. The course is designed to train delegates in the safe assembly, use and dismantle of mobile access towers. On successful completion of the PASMA course delegates will receive a PASMA operators certificate and identification card valid for 5 years.
